Disc shape spargers are a type of gas-liquid dispersion device commonly used in chemical and biological processes. Here are 10 questions you should know about disc shape spargers:

1. What is a disc shape sparger?

A disc shape sparger is a device used to introduce gas into a liquid. It consists of a disc-shaped plate with holes or slots for gas to escape and disperse into the liquid.

2. How does a disc shape sparger work?

When gas is forced through the holes or slots in the disc shape sparger, it breaks up into tiny bubbles that are dispersed throughout the liquid. This increases the surface area of the gas-liquid interface, allowing for more efficient mass transfer.

3. What are the advantages of using a disc shape sparger?

Disc shape spargers are known for their high gas holdup, uniform bubble distribution, and good mixing characteristics. They are also easy to clean and maintain, making them ideal for continuous processes.

4. What types of applications are disc shape spargers used for?

Disc shape spargers are commonly used in fermentation, wastewater treatment, chemical reactions, and pharmaceutical processes. They can be used for a wide range of gas-liquid reactions and separations.

5. How do you choose the right disc shape sparger for your application?

When choosing a disc shape sparger, factors to consider include gas flow rate, liquid flow rate, bubble size requirements, and the compatibility of materials with the process conditions. It is important to work with a supplier who can provide custom-designed spargers for your specific needs.

6. Are there any limitations to using disc shape spargers?

One limitation of disc shape spargers is the potential for clogging, especially when used with viscous or particulate-laden liquids. Proper design and maintenance can help mitigate this issue.

7. How can the performance of disc shape spargers be optimized?

Optimizing the performance of disc shape spargers involves adjusting operating conditions such as gas flow rate, liquid flow rate, and sparger location. Computational fluid dynamics (CFD) simulation can also be used to optimize sparger design.

8. What are the main considerations for designing disc shape spargers?

When designing disc shape spargers, factors to consider include the size and shape of the sparger plate, the spacing and size of the holes or slots, and the location of the sparger in the vessel. These design parameters can affect gas-liquid mixing and mass transfer efficiency.

9. How do disc shape spargers compare to other types of spargers?

Disc shape spargers offer advantages such as uniform bubble distribution and good mixing characteristics, making them suitable for a wide range of applications. Other types of spargers, such as porous media spargers or needle spargers, may be more appropriate for specific applications.
